Summary: The Systems Analyst II for Development and Construction plays a key role in supporting and optimizing business applications and technology services across operations. Primary platforms include ArcGIS, Autodesk AEC, Procore, and Heavy Job. This role ensures systems are reliable, integrated, and aligned with both field and office workflows to improve efficiency, accuracy, and productivity. The analyst supports construction technology deployment, maintains consistent IT service delivery, and manages logistics for technology mobilization across job sites and offices.

Acting as a bridge between IT, field teams, and business stakeholders, the analyst provides support, oversees application lifecycles, and leads continuous improvement to meet evolving business needs.
